TitleReports on excavations at Kent's Cavern by William Pengelly and Edward Vivian
Date1865-1880
DescriptionReports by William Pengelly FRS (1812-1894) and Edward Vivian, superintendents of exploration at Kent's Cavern near Torquay in Devon. Produced for the Kent's Cavern Committee of the British Association for the Advancement of Science. With some supporting correspondence.
LanguageEnglish
Extent1 volume, MS Large
FormatManuscript
PhysicalDescriptionHalf-bound in red leather, red cloth boards. Spine tooled in gold: "Kent's Cavern Reports. W. Pengelly, F.R.S. 1865-1880.' Bookplate of John Evans.
